Patna: The government registered Patna Smart City Limited, under the Companies Act, 2013, to execute the smart city mission. Patna commissioner Anand Kishor, who will be the chairman, said the authorised capital of the company will be Rs 400 crore and the paid-up capital will be Rs 10 lakh.

Company secretary Ajay Kumar presented a registration certificate to Kishor. The firm will have a four-member board of directors. Town commissioner Abhishek Singh will be the managing director and deputy secretary, urban development, KD Prajwal and deputy secretary, finance, will be directors.
